Influence of the Morphology of Barium Strontium Titanate Thin Films on the Ferroelectric and Dielectric Properties

In the present study, Ba_(0.8)Sr_(0.2)TiO_3 thin films were realized by chemical solution deposition and spin-coating on stainless steel substrates using the classical multi-layer technique. In order to influence the morphology of the films, three solutions with a different concentration, 0.1 M (BST0.1M), 0.3 M (BST0.3M) and 0.6 M (BST0.6M), were prepared. The dilution is shown to influence the grain size of the films and as consequence also its ferroelectric and dielectric properties.
